Yeah, her reaction to castle Clinton is glitched. I want to say that if you kill one person and knock everyone else out, she gets pissed that you were too soft on them, but if you KO everyone, you're "not afraid to kill".
|
# ? May 14, 2020 17:42 |
|
The interaction about castle Clinton is flagged depending on your exit entrance. If you leave castle Clinton through front door Navarre assumes everyone is dead.

The gold was a bit much, the problem isn't that the DC toned it down but that it was ripped out and replaced with nothing.
|
# ? May 20, 2020 10:00 |
|
I really enjoyed the whole Greek/Roman thematic they were originally going for, including the gold filter. It made DX feel distinguished in a field of grey/brown modern shooters that's plagued the market since HL2/Modern Warfare. But people want realism so it's back to harsh, stark-white florescent lights and muted greys.
|
# ? May 20, 2020 15:27 |
|
Yeah whether you like the gold or not, the game's design aesthetic was designed with it in mind and if you just rip it out it's going to look like trash
